Venue details
Ambiance
Small, hands-on organic winery on a quiet street in Villány, offering intimate, low-intervention tastings that focus on terroir-driven natural wines rather than a polished tourist experience.[0][6]

At the Vineyard
- Appellation
- Villány wine region (DHC Villány; PGI Transdanubia)
- Varietals
- Hárslevelű, Blauer Portugieser/Portugieser, Kékfrankos, Merlot, Cabernet Franc
